Hotch was a leader, one with huge responsabilities. Everyday he had to take the right decisions in order to maintain people alive, wether it was the members of his team or the potential victims of serial killers. So yes, he took that very seriously and it had a huge impact on his humor. Not to mention that he had had his share of pain, mental and physical. But emotionless, the guy was not. As a leader, he just knew how to keep his emotions in control and he did a very good job at that. But we saw him express his emotions plenty of times with Jack, with Haley and with each and every member of the team. We saw him smile (and oh does he have a gorgeous smile !), we saw him in despair, we saw him cry. How does that make him emotionless ? |

I've seen some people say they felt Hotch was emotionless and wooden. But I don't agree. He may not have always easily shown his emotions but he did have them. He was just very stoic and put on a brave face a lot of the time. But you could tell he cared about his family and team. But I liked that Hotch wasn't necessarily an open book.
